[JIRA] Hide Top Bar/Navigation Menu buttons based on Groups

changmle August 6, 2019

Hi all, 

 

Is there a quick way to hide some buttons (Project, Issues etc) from the top bar/navigation menu of JIRA from a specific group of users?

 

Thank you!

Hi @changmle 

Why don't you work with permissions ? If you give access to only one project to a group, this group will only see this project when thay click on the project button. And they will only can create issue in this particular project.

changmle August 6, 2019

The requirement is to hide the top bar buttons from a group of users, even if they have permission to one project, they shouldnt see the dropdown button "Projects" from the top bar.
